In the 9th and 10th centuries, the Warnowers, a Slavic people, settled on the lake, built a mighty ring wall on the (then) island and thus a castle that could only be reached via a bridge, and their village on the headland in front of it. All of this was excavated again (from 1973 onwards), and because everything was well preserved by the moor, it became an open-air museum and we can look at it. Very interesting, highly recommended. Frequently Asked Questions

What types of castles can I explore around Sternberg?

The region around Sternberg offers a diverse range of historical sites. You can visit well-preserved historic castles like Kaarz Castle, which now functions as a hotel and restaurant. There's also the unique Open-Air Museum Groß Raden – Slavic fort and settlement, a reconstruction of a 9th/10th-century Slavic castle. Additionally, you can observe structures built in the style of famous castles, such as Katelbogen Castle, which resembles Neuschwanstein.

Are there family-friendly castles or historical sites near Sternberg?

Yes, several sites are suitable for families. Kaarz Castle offers beautiful parks for walking and relaxation. The Open-Air Museum Groß Raden – Slavic fort and settlement is particularly family-friendly, allowing visitors to experience the life of the Slavs from the 9th/10th centuries firsthand.

What historical insights can I gain from visiting the castles in this region?

The castles around Sternberg provide a glimpse into various historical periods. The Open-Air Museum Groß Raden reconstructs a Slavic fort and settlement from the 9th and 10th centuries, offering insights into early medieval life. Other castles, like Kaarz Castle, showcase later architectural styles and transformations, reflecting centuries of regional history.
